In this blog site post, we'll check out the advantages, functions, and top options offered in the all-terrain stroller market, while addressing some frequently asked concerns to assist you make an informed option.<br>What is an All-Terrain Stroller?<br>An all-terrain stroller is developed specifically for adaptability and toughness, enabling it to perform well on a range of surfaces, consisting of gravel courses, muddy trails, and smooth pavements. With bigger wheels, enhanced suspension systems, and rugged building and construction, these strollers allow moms and dads to preserve an active lifestyle while guaranteeing their child remains safe and comfy.<br>Benefits of All-Terrain StrollersAdvantageDescriptionAdaptabilityCan be utilized on numerous surfaces, from parks to city streets.ResilienceDeveloped with robust materials to endure harsher conditions.ConvenienceFrequently features better suspension and cushioning for a smooth trip.Storage CapacityLots of models include ample storage for baby gear and personal products.Security FeaturesEquipped with safety harnesses, brakes, and reflective products.Key Features to Look For<br>When selecting an all-terrain stroller, consider the following features to guarantee you get the best design for your requirements:<br>Wheels: Larger, air-filled tires are more effective for shock absorption and maneuvering over irregular surfaces.Suspension System: A top quality suspension system can provide a smoother trip for your baby.Foldability: Look for strollers that are easy to fold and lightweight to carry.Canopy Size: A large canopy will secure your kid from the sun and wind.Storage Space: A stroller with adequate undercarriage storage will accommodate your fundamentals while on the go.Security Features: Ensure it has a reliable braking system and restraints.Leading All-Terrain Strollers of 2023<br>To provide parents a clearer sense of what's offered on the marketplace, here's a table contrasting some of the best all-terrain strollers currently readily available:<br>Stroller ModelWeight LimitWeightWheel TypeCanopy SizeFoldabilityCostBaby Jogger Summit X375 lbs28 poundsAir-filledLargeOne-handed₤ 499BOB Gear Revolution Flex 3.075 lbs28.5 lbsPneumaticAdditional LargeOne-handed₤ 499Thule Urban Glide 275 pounds24 poundsAir-filledAdjustableOne-handed₤ 499Joovy Zoom 360 Ultralight75 pounds26 lbsFoam-filledLargeTwo-handed₤ 249Baby Trend Expedition50 lbs25 lbsAll-terrain3-positionOne-handed₤ 129Frequently Asked QuestionsQ1: Are all-terrain strollers suitable for babies?<br>A: Most all-terrain strollers are created for children aged 6 months and up. However, numerous designs offer compatibility with infant automobile seats, permitting use from birth with the addition of a safety seat adapter.<br>Q2: Can I use an all-terrain stroller for running?<br>A: While many all-terrain strollers are designed for an active lifestyle, not all are appropriate for running. Always inspect the maker's recommendations. If running is a top priority, consider designs specifically labeled as running strollers.<br>Q3: Are all-terrain strollers heavier than standard strollers?<br>A: Generally, yes. All-terrain strollers are constructed to be more long lasting and rugged, which can lead to a heavier frame. Nevertheless, designs are improving, and some models are reasonably lightweight.<br>Q4: What is the average lifespan of an all-terrain stroller?<br>A: The life-span of an all-terrain stroller can vary but usually varies from 3 to 5 years, depending on usage and upkeep.<br>Q5: How do I maintain my all-terrain stroller?<br>A: Regular upkeep consists of checking tire pressure, cleaning up the wheels, lubing joints, and guaranteeing the brakes are functional.
